ProfileHighlighting: Sort keywords correctly

Task-number: QTCREATORBUG-10622
Change-Id: I96a68627eb4fad37526f43519ede929e727b4908
Reviewed-by: Jarek Kobus <jaroslaw.kobus@digia.com>
This commit is contained in:
Daniel Teske
2013-11-11 14:39:18 +01:00
parent d3e0ad9429
commit 33438efc98

View File

@@ -48,7 +48,6 @@ static const char *const variableKeywords[] = {
"DESTDIR_TARGET", "DESTDIR_TARGET",
"DISTFILES", "DISTFILES",
"DLLDESTDIR", "DLLDESTDIR",
"DISTFILES",
"DSP_TEMPLATE", "DSP_TEMPLATE",
"FORMS", "FORMS",
"FORMS3", "FORMS3",
@@ -72,12 +71,12 @@ static const char *const variableKeywords[] = {
"OBJECTS_DIR", "OBJECTS_DIR",
"OBJMOC", "OBJMOC",
"OTHER_FILES", "OTHER_FILES",
"OUT_PWD",
"PKGCONFIG", "PKGCONFIG",
"POST_TARGETDEPS", "POST_TARGETDEPS",
"PRE_TARGETDEPS",
"PRECOMPILED_HEADER", "PRECOMPILED_HEADER",
"PRE_TARGETDEPS",
"PWD", "PWD",
"OUT_PWD",
"QMAKE", "QMAKE",
"QMAKESPEC", "QMAKESPEC",
"QMAKE_APP_FLAG", "QMAKE_APP_FLAG",
@@ -111,16 +110,16 @@ static const char *const variableKeywords[] = {
"QMAKE_CXXFLAGS_WARN_ON", "QMAKE_CXXFLAGS_WARN_ON",
"QMAKE_DISTCLEAN", "QMAKE_DISTCLEAN",
"QMAKE_EXTENSION_SHLIB", "QMAKE_EXTENSION_SHLIB",
"QMAKE_EXT_MOC",
"QMAKE_EXT_UI",
"QMAKE_EXT_PRL",
"QMAKE_EXT_LEX",
"QMAKE_EXT_YACC",
"QMAKE_EXT_OBJ",
"QMAKE_EXT_CPP",
"QMAKE_EXT_H",
"QMAKE_EXTRA_COMPILERS", "QMAKE_EXTRA_COMPILERS",
"QMAKE_EXTRA_TARGETS", "QMAKE_EXTRA_TARGETS",
"QMAKE_EXT_CPP",
"QMAKE_EXT_H",
"QMAKE_EXT_LEX",
"QMAKE_EXT_MOC",
"QMAKE_EXT_OBJ",
"QMAKE_EXT_PRL",
"QMAKE_EXT_UI",
"QMAKE_EXT_YACC",
"QMAKE_FAILED_REQUIREMENTS", "QMAKE_FAILED_REQUIREMENTS",
"QMAKE_FRAMEWORK_BUNDLE_NAME", "QMAKE_FRAMEWORK_BUNDLE_NAME",
"QMAKE_FRAMEWORK_VERSION", "QMAKE_FRAMEWORK_VERSION",
@@ -139,9 +138,9 @@ static const char *const variableKeywords[] = {
"QMAKE_LFLAGS_CONSOLE_DLL", "QMAKE_LFLAGS_CONSOLE_DLL",
"QMAKE_LFLAGS_DEBUG", "QMAKE_LFLAGS_DEBUG",
"QMAKE_LFLAGS_PLUGIN", "QMAKE_LFLAGS_PLUGIN",
"QMAKE_LFLAGS_RPATH",
"QMAKE_LFLAGS_QT_DLL", "QMAKE_LFLAGS_QT_DLL",
"QMAKE_LFLAGS_RELEASE", "QMAKE_LFLAGS_RELEASE",
"QMAKE_LFLAGS_RPATH",
"QMAKE_LFLAGS_SHAPP", "QMAKE_LFLAGS_SHAPP",
"QMAKE_LFLAGS_SHLIB", "QMAKE_LFLAGS_SHLIB",
"QMAKE_LFLAGS_SONAME", "QMAKE_LFLAGS_SONAME",
@@ -149,8 +148,8 @@ static const char *const variableKeywords[] = {
"QMAKE_LFLAGS_WINDOWS", "QMAKE_LFLAGS_WINDOWS",
"QMAKE_LFLAGS_WINDOWS_DLL", "QMAKE_LFLAGS_WINDOWS_DLL",
"QMAKE_LIBDIR", "QMAKE_LIBDIR",
"QMAKE_LIBDIR_FLAGS",
"QMAKE_LIBDIR_EGL", "QMAKE_LIBDIR_EGL",
"QMAKE_LIBDIR_FLAGS",
"QMAKE_LIBDIR_OPENGL", "QMAKE_LIBDIR_OPENGL",
"QMAKE_LIBDIR_OPENVG", "QMAKE_LIBDIR_OPENVG",
"QMAKE_LIBDIR_QT", "QMAKE_LIBDIR_QT",
@@ -159,9 +158,9 @@ static const char *const variableKeywords[] = {
"QMAKE_LIBS_CONSOLE", "QMAKE_LIBS_CONSOLE",
"QMAKE_LIBS_EGL", "QMAKE_LIBS_EGL",
"QMAKE_LIBS_OPENGL", "QMAKE_LIBS_OPENGL",
"QMAKE_LIBS_OPENGL_QT",
"QMAKE_LIBS_OPENGL_ES1", "QMAKE_LIBS_OPENGL_ES1",
"QMAKE_LIBS_OPENGL_ES2", "QMAKE_LIBS_OPENGL_ES2",
"QMAKE_LIBS_OPENGL_QT",
"QMAKE_LIBS_OPENVG", "QMAKE_LIBS_OPENVG",
"QMAKE_LIBS_QT", "QMAKE_LIBS_QT",
"QMAKE_LIBS_QT_DLL", "QMAKE_LIBS_QT_DLL",
@@ -176,13 +175,13 @@ static const char *const variableKeywords[] = {
"QMAKE_LIB_FLAG", "QMAKE_LIB_FLAG",
"QMAKE_LINK_SHLIB_CMD", "QMAKE_LINK_SHLIB_CMD",
"QMAKE_LN_SHLIB", "QMAKE_LN_SHLIB",
"QMAKE_MACOSX_DEPLOYMENT_TARGET",
"QMAKE_MAC_SDK",
"QMAKE_MAKEFILE",
"QMAKE_MOC_SRC",
"QMAKE_POST_LINK", "QMAKE_POST_LINK",
"QMAKE_PRE_LINK", "QMAKE_PRE_LINK",
"QMAKE_PROJECT_NAME", "QMAKE_PROJECT_NAME",
"QMAKE_MAC_SDK",
"QMAKE_MACOSX_DEPLOYMENT_TARGET",
"QMAKE_MAKEFILE",
"QMAKE_MOC_SRC",
"QMAKE_QMAKE", "QMAKE_QMAKE",
"QMAKE_QT_DLL", "QMAKE_QT_DLL",
"QMAKE_RESOURCE_FLAGS", "QMAKE_RESOURCE_FLAGS",
@@ -196,10 +195,10 @@ static const char *const variableKeywords[] = {
"QMAKE_UIC", "QMAKE_UIC",
"QT", "QT",
"QTPLUGIN", "QTPLUGIN",
"QT_VERSION",
"QT_MAJOR_VERSION", "QT_MAJOR_VERSION",
"QT_MINOR_VERSION", "QT_MINOR_VERSION",
"QT_PATCH_VERSION", "QT_PATCH_VERSION",
"QT_VERSION",
"RCC_DIR", "RCC_DIR",
"RC_FILE", "RC_FILE",
"REQUIRES", "REQUIRES",
@@ -219,10 +218,10 @@ static const char *const variableKeywords[] = {
"UI_DIR", "UI_DIR",
"UI_HEADERS_DIR", "UI_HEADERS_DIR",
"UI_SOURCES_DIR", "UI_SOURCES_DIR",
"VERSION",
"VER_MAJ", "VER_MAJ",
"VER_MIN", "VER_MIN",
"VER_PAT", "VER_PAT",
"VERSION",
"VPATH", "VPATH",
"YACCIMPLS", "YACCIMPLS",
"YACCOBJECTS", "YACCOBJECTS",